Output 2663c1a399adb8c1b10ae775279149ca3904ed8428f21f0353227a247446abc6:0

value
201128000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ac23fee95cbc9554798c0c24811768266d67bef0 OP_EQUALVERIFY OP_CHECKSIG
address
1GhCM2MHcDppS4H31n13thALVaVT8R8rJ7
transaction
2663c1a399adb8c1b10ae775279149ca3904ed8428f21f0353227a247446abc6
spent
true